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Altai Mole | 黑头闪羽蜂鸟 |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(动物界) | Animalia (动物界)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(脊索动物门) | Chordata (脊索动物门) |
| Class | Mammalia (哺乳動物) | Aves (鳥綱) |
| Order | Soricomorpha (鼩形目) | Apodiformes (雨燕目) |
| Family | Talpidae | Trochilidae |
| Genus | Talpa | Aglaeactis |
| Species | Talpa altaica | Aglaeactis pamela |
Evolutionary Relationship
Altai Mole and 黑头闪羽蜂鸟 share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(脊索动物门)
